Neutrons released by nuclear fission. When 235 U fission occurs by slow neutrons, 99.25% of all fission neutrons are released immediately after the fission as prompt neutrons. The remaining proportion are released later as delayed neutrons. The energy of fission neutrons ranges from over 10 MeV to thermal energy, but most are between 1 MeV and 2 MeV. The average number of neutrons released from the fission of 235 U and 239 Pu by thermal neutrons is 2.5 and 1.83, respectively.
